Browsing: Biology
Biology is the scientific study of life and living organisms, encompassing a vast range of topics from the molecular mechanisms inside cells to the behavior of ecosystems and the evolution of species over time. It explores how organisms grow, reproduce, interact with their environments, and adapt to changing conditions. Subfields such as genetics, microbiology, physiology, ecology, and evolutionary biology provide focused lenses through which scientists investigate the complexity of life. As a foundational science, biology not only deepens our understanding of the natural world but also drives advancements in medicine, agriculture, biotechnology, and conservation.
